An inspection manual is an essential document to help new hires learn the ropes of what will be expected of them at your company, and it’s also vital in keeping existing employees up-to-date on any changes to your methods or processes. With so many benefits available, there’s no reason not to implement an inspection manual for your business! Here are nine reasons why your company needs an inspection manual, including who it can help, how it can be beneficial, and tips on how to create one.
1) Save Time
Inspections are generally needed when something needs to be checked. Conducting these inspections can sometimes eat up a lot of time and resources. By having a manual with pre-approved checklists, companies can ensure that they’re checking off all of the items on their list—without any guesswork or confusion. This helps save time, money, and effort.
2) Create Consistency
In a small business, it’s up to you to keep everything in order. The only way to do that is to be diligent about maintaining records, conducting regular inspections, and keeping track of your inventory—and there’s no more efficient way to do all three than with a company inspection manual. A comprehensive inspection manual ensures that every employee knows what needs to be done when and how often.

4) Share Procedures & Best Practices
By sharing procedures, you can make sure each member of your team has a clear understanding of expectations and goals. If everyone is working toward similar goals, using standardized methods, and following routine procedures, there’s less room for error (and fewer reasons to ask questions). Making sure your employees all have access to your inspection manual makes it easy for them to see what’s expected from them.

9) Decrease Injuries
Injuries cost businesses billions of dollars each year, and most of these injuries are preventable. While your employees know what they should do to keep themselves safe on the job, you can’t assume that they will. A good way to make sure your employees are always looking out for their own safety is by implementing a formal inspection manual. An inspection manual will outline all of your company’s safety procedures, as well as provide instructions for new hires and training materials for veteran employees.
